Caffeine induces age-dependent brain complexity and criticality during sleep
neutralTechnology
Scientists have discovered that caffeine affects brain activity during sleep in ways that vary by age—boosting complexity and "criticality" (a sweet spot for optimal brain function) in younger brains, but potentially disrupting it in older ones. The study suggests caffeine might help younger people’s brains process information more efficiently during sleep, while older adults could see less benefit or even drawbacks.

FLUX.1 Kontext enables in-context image generation for enterprise AI pipelines
positiveTechnology
Black Forest Labs just dropped FLUX.1 Kontext, a new tool designed to streamline image editing in AI workflows. Unlike traditional methods, it lets users tweak images repeatedly—using text prompts or reference images—without slowing things down. Think of it like a "non-destructive edit" feature for generative AI, but built for businesses juggling complex creative pipelines.
